Abstract

Canine babesiosis is an important tick-borne disease caused by Babesia spp. A total of 130 blood samples were randomly collected from pet dogs in Zhengzhou city, Henan Province, China, and screened for the presence of piroplasms with nested PCR and gene sequencing targeting the 18S rRNA gene. On the basis of blast analysis of the 18S rRNA gene sequences, our results revealed that seven dogs (5.4%) were infected with Babesia canis canis. The sequences were compared with those in GenBank, and alignments showed that all B. canis canis isolates belonged to genotype B. This is the first report of B. canis canis infection in dogs in China.

摘要

犬巴贝斯虫病是由巴贝斯虫属引起的一种重要的蜱传疾病。在中国河南省郑州市,从宠物狗中随机采集了130份血样,采用巢式PCR和针对18S rRNA基因的基因测序技术筛查梨形虫的存在情况。基于对18S rRNA基因序列的比对分析,我们的结果显示有7只犬(5.4%)感染了犬巴贝斯虫。将这些序列与GenBank中的序列进行比较,比对结果表明所有犬巴贝斯虫分离株均属于B基因型。这是中国犬感染犬巴贝斯虫的首次报道。
